Riboflavin (vitamin B2)

In the current application an authorisation is sought under Article 4(1) for riboflavin (vitamin B2) as feed additive under the category/functional group 3(a) "nutritional additive"/"vitamins, provitamins and chemically well-defined substances having a similar effect" according to the classification system of Annex I of Regulation (EC) No 1831/2003. The authorisation is sought for the use of the feed additive for all animal species.
The product presented by the Applicant contains riboflavin as active substance produced by fermentation with a genetically modified Bacillus subtilis VBB18049. According to the Applicant, the active substance is included in two different formulations containing respectively a minimum of 98 % (w/w) and a minimum of 80 % (w/w) riboflavin. The feed additive is intended to be added directly into compound feed (or through premixtures) and water for drinking. However, the Applicant did not propose any specific inclusion level of the active substance in the above-mentioned matrices.
For the determination of riboflavin in the product containing a minimum of 98 % (w/w) active substance, the Applicant proposed to apply the methods included in the European Pharmacopoeia riboflavin monograph. Identification is based on specific optical rotation, thin-layer chromatography and ultraviolet/visible spectrophotometry, while quantification is based on spectrophotometry at 444 nm. Therefore, the EURL recommends for official control the methods described in the European Pharmacopoeia riboflavin monograph to determine riboflavin in the feed additive (containing a minimum of 98 % (w/w) active substance only).
Moreover, for similar authorised feed additives, the EURL, for the determination of riboflavin in the feed additive and premixtures, evaluated and recommended the VDLUFA (Association of German Agricultural Analytical Research Institutes) method (Bd. III, 13.9.1) based on ion-pair reversed phase HPLC coupled to UV detection (HPLC-UV). The VDLUFA method is intended for the analysis of vitamin B2 in the feed additive, premixtures and mineral feeds. Based on the performance characteristics, the EURL recommends for official control the ring-trial validated VDLUFA method (Bd. III, 13.9.1) to determine riboflavin in the feed additive and in premixtures.
For the determination of riboflavin (as total vitamin B2) in compound feed and water the EURL formerly evaluated and recommended the ring-trial validated CEN method intended for foodstuffs (EN 14152). The analytical method is based on acidic hydrolysis followed by HPLC coupled to fluorescence detection (FLD). Based on the performance characteristics, the EURL recommends for official control the ring-trial validated CEN method (EN 14152:2003) to determine riboflavin (as total vitamin B2) in compound feed and water. Further testing or validation of the methods to be performed through the consortium of National Reference Laboratories as specified by Article 10 (Commission Regulation (EC) No 378/2005, as last amended by Regulation (EU) 2015/1761) is not considered necessary.
